What is Dyscalculia?

Dyscalculia is a learning disorder that primarily impacts an individual’s mathematical abilities. It is characterized by difficulties in understanding and processing numerical information, which can greatly affect daily life and academic performance. Unlike occasional struggles with math that many people experience, Dyscalculia is a persistent and chronic condition that requires specific support and interventions.

Causes and Prevalence of Dyscalculia

The exact causes of Dyscalculia are not yet fully understood, but researchers believe that both genetic and environmental factors may contribute to its development. Additionally, brain imaging studies have shown that individuals with Dyscalculia exhibit differences in brain activation patterns when performing mathematical tasks.

As for prevalence, it is estimated that Dyscalculia affects around 5-7% of the population, making it as common as Dyslexia. However, due to the lack of awareness and proper diagnosis, many individuals with Dyscalculia go undiagnosed and do not receive appropriate support.

Common Dyscalculia Symptoms

Dyscalculia is a learning disorder that affects an individual’s ability to understand and work with numbers. The symptoms of Dyscalculia can vary from person to person, but there are some common signs to look out for. Recognizing these symptoms is crucial in seeking appropriate support and intervention.

Here are some common Dyscalculia symptoms:

  • Difficulty with number recognition: Individuals with Dyscalculia may struggle to recognize and differentiate between numbers. This can lead to difficulties in reading and writing numerical symbols accurately.
  • Challenges with basic arithmetic: Performing simple calculations, such as addition, subtraction, multiplication, and division, can be difficult for individuals with Dyscalculia. They may struggle to understand the concepts and apply the appropriate methods.
  • Poor understanding of mathematical concepts: Dyscalculia can cause difficulty in grasping fundamental mathematical concepts, such as place value, fractions, and measurements. This can hinder overall mathematical comprehension.
  • Trouble with spatial reasoning: Individuals with Dyscalculia may struggle with spatial awareness and visualizing patterns or relationships between objects. This can affect their ability to understand geometry and solve spatial problems.
  • Inconsistent number sense: Dyscalculics may have difficulty estimating quantities or understanding the relative size of numbers. This can lead to challenges in everyday tasks that require number sense, such as estimating time or measuring ingredients.
  • Difficulty with sequencing: Sequencing numbers or steps in a math problem can be challenging for individuals with Dyscalculia. This can impact their ability to follow multi-step instructions and solve complex mathematical problems.

Taking a Dyscalculia Test

If you suspect you may have Dyscalculia, taking a dyscalculia test can help provide a formal diagnosis and guide you towards appropriate support and intervention. There are several tests and assessments available that are specifically designed to evaluate mathematical difficulties and determine the presence of Dyscalculia.

These tests are conducted by qualified professionals, such as psychologists or educational specialists, who are trained in assessing learning disorders. The process typically involves a comprehensive evaluation of the individual’s mathematical abilities, including number sense, spatial reasoning, and problem-solving skills.

During a Dyscalculia assessment, different areas may be assessed, such as:

  • Number recognition and understanding
  • Calculation skills and arithmetic fluency
  • Working memory and cognitive processing
  • Visual-spatial skills and geometrical reasoning

The Diagnostic Process

Obtaining a Dyscalculia diagnosis typically involves several steps, which may vary depending on the healthcare provider or educational institution. The process generally includes:

  1. Evaluation of Background Information: The specialist will gather information about the individual’s medical and developmental history, including any previous assessments, academic records, and observations from teachers and/or parents.
  2. Comprehensive Assessment: A variety of assessment tools and tests may be administered to evaluate different aspects of mathematical abilities, such as number sense, spatial reasoning, and mathematical problem-solving. These assessments can help identify specific areas of difficulty and determine if Dyscalculia is the likely cause.
  3. Clinical Interview: The specialist will conduct an in-depth interview to gain a better understanding of the individual’s experiences, challenges, and strategies used to cope with math-related tasks.

It is important to note that a Dyscalculia diagnosis should be conducted by qualified professionals, such as psychologists or educational specialists, who have expertise in assessing learning disabilities. Seeking a diagnosis from a qualified specialist ensures accurate and reliable results.

Dyscalculia Treatment Options

In this section, we will explore the various treatment options available for individuals with Dyscalculia. Effective interventions, therapy approaches, and assistive technologies can play a crucial role in managing and overcoming the challenges associated with this learning disorder.

Educational Interventions

Educational interventions are key in helping individuals with Dyscalculia develop essential numeracy and mathematical skills. These interventions often include:

  • Multi-sensory teaching methods: These methods engage different senses, such as visual, auditory, and kinesthetic, to enhance learning and understanding.
  • Structured and sequential instruction: Breaking down mathematical concepts into smaller, manageable steps can help individuals grasp and retain information more effectively.
  • Customized learning plans: Tailoring instruction to the individual’s specific needs and learning style can optimize their progress and success.
  • Repeated practice and reinforcement: Providing ample opportunities for practice and repetition can strengthen mathematical skills and build confidence.

Therapy Approaches

Therapy approaches can complement educational interventions and address the underlying cognitive and emotional aspects of Dyscalculia. Here are some therapy options that may be beneficial:

  • Cognitive-behavioral therapy (CBT): CBT can help individuals manage any negative thoughts, emotions, or anxiety related to math. It can also provide strategies for problem-solving and building resilience.
  • Psychological counseling: Counseling sessions can provide emotional support, address self-esteem issues, and promote a positive mindset towards mathematics.
  • Executive function training: Building executive function skills, such as organization, planning, and working memory, can improve overall cognitive functioning and mathematical abilities.
  • Occupational therapy: Occupational therapy can focus on developing fine motor skills, visual-spatial skills, and coordination, which are essential for success in various math-related activities.

Assistive Technologies

The advancements in technology have brought a wide range of assistive tools and technologies for individuals with Dyscalculia. These tools can provide additional support and facilitate independent learning. Here are some commonly used assistive technologies:

  • Mathematical software and apps: These tools offer interactive and visual representations of mathematical concepts, making them more accessible and engaging.
  • Text-to-speech and speech-to-text software: These programs can help individuals with Dyscalculia by converting mathematical text into spoken words or transcribing spoken responses into written form.
  • Graphing calculators: Graphing calculators can simplify complex mathematical calculations and enable individuals to visualize mathematical relationships.
  • Digital organizers and planners: These tools can assist with managing deadlines, organizing assignments, and tracking progress, helping individuals stay organized and focused.

Accommodations and Support for Dyscalculia

Dyscalculia is a learning disorder that can present significant challenges in mathematical and numerical comprehension. However, with the right accommodations and support systems in place, individuals with Dyscalculia can thrive academically and overcome barriers to success.

Strategies for Teachers

In the classroom, teachers play a vital role in providing support to students with Dyscalculia. By adopting evidence-based instructional strategies, they can create an inclusive learning environment that caters to the individual needs of students.

  • Use multisensory teaching methods: Engaging multiple senses, such as visual and tactile, can help students with Dyscalculia better understand and retain mathematical concepts.
  • Break down complex problems: Breaking down complex problems into smaller, more manageable steps can alleviate feelings of overwhelm and ensure progressive learning.
  • Provide visual aids: Visual aids, like charts, diagrams, and manipulatives, can enhance understanding and reinforce mathematical concepts.
  • Allow extra time for assignments and tests: Providing additional time for students to complete assignments and tests can help mitigate the processing difficulties associated with Dyscalculia.

Strategies for Parents

Support from parents is crucial in helping students with Dyscalculia navigate their academic journey. By implementing the following strategies, parents can provide the necessary guidance and encouragement at home.

  • Create a supportive learning environment: Establishing a quiet and clutter-free space for studying can help minimize distractions and improve focus.
  • Utilize real-life applications: Encouraging the use of math in daily life, such as during grocery shopping or cooking, can reinforce concepts and promote practical application.
  • Advocate for accommodations: Collaborating with teachers and school administrators to ensure appropriate accommodations, such as extra time or specialized instructional techniques, can help level the playing field for students with Dyscalculia.
  • Provide emotional support: Recognizing the challenges associated with Dyscalculia and offering emotional support and reassurance can boost confidence and motivation.

Strategies for Individuals

Individuals with Dyscalculia can also implement strategies to support their own learning process and improve mathematical skills.

  • Use technology and assistive tools: There are numerous digital resources, apps, and assistive technologies available that can facilitate mathematical understanding and calculations.
  • Break down tasks: Breaking down complex tasks into smaller, manageable steps can help maintain focus and reduce frustration.
  • Seek peer support: Connecting with other individuals who have Dyscalculia through support groups or online communities can provide a sense of belonging and opportunities for shared learning.
  • Practice self-advocacy: Learning to communicate your needs and advocate for accommodations or modifications can empower individuals with Dyscalculia to navigate academic and professional environments effectively.
